  4. 17 de may. de 2024 · Mansfield Park, novel by Jane Austen, published in three volumes in 1814.In its tone and discussion of religion and religious duty, it is the most serious of Austen’s novels. The heroine, Fanny Price, is a self-effacing and unregarded cousin cared for by the Bertram family in their country house. Mansfield Park is the third published novel by the English author Jane Austen, first published in 1814 by Thomas Egerton.A second edition was published in 1816 by John Murray, still within Austen's lifetime.The novel did not receive any public reviews until 1821.
